BPC-157 is one of the most-studied peptides in animals — and one of the least-studied in humans. There are 100+ animal studies, but fewer than 30 people have ever been in a published BPC-157 study, and not one was a proper controlled trial. So when TikTok says it "heals everything," the honest answer is: it's promising in rats, largely unproven in people.

What it is
BPC-157 ("Body Protection Compound-157") is a synthetic 15-amino-acid peptide based on a sequence found in human gastric juice. In animal studies it's been linked to tissue repair through several plausible mechanisms — promoting new blood-vessel growth (VEGF), modulating nitric oxide, and reducing inflammatory signals.
It is not FDA-approved for any use, sits on the FDA's Category 2 list (can't currently be legally compounded due to insufficient safety data), and was banned by the NFL, UFC, NCAA and WADA around 2022. In April 2026 the UK's medicines regulator (MHRA) opened an investigation into peptide clinics marketing it, naming BPC-157 first.

The internet vs. the evidence
"BPC-157 heals tendons, joints, gut, and nerves. It's a proven recovery miracle — the body's own repair peptide. Everyone in the gym is on it."
Decades of animal research make it scientifically interesting, but fewer than 30 humans have ever been studied and no controlled trial has been completed. "Proven" is the wrong word — "promising but largely untested in people" is accurate.
What was actually studied
Note: all three published human studies share the same lead investigator, and none used a placebo control. Widely-shared "protocols" online are extrapolated from rodent studies and community practice — not from human dose-finding trials, which don't yet exist.
